ImageBanner supports background video uploads
ImageBanner is not limited to static images. Background video uploads are supported in production.
What to expect
- You can upload a background video for an ImageBanner.
- If you were trying to use animation because the image field would not accept a
.webmfile, use the banner's video/background-video capability instead of treating the file as a static image. - For the new banner experience, the slider-based implementation is used, and video is supported there as well.
Troubleshooting
If a .webm file is rejected specifically by an image-only upload field, that does not mean video banners are unsupported overall. It usually means the media needs to be uploaded through the banner's video/background-video path rather than the image field.
